This gives the phone's coulomb counter a clean reference curve against the new cell before it starts reporting percentage readings to the OS.\u003c\/li\u003e\n  \u003c\/ul\u003e\n\n  \u003chr class=\"bpw-desc-divider\"\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eWhy the Spice C5300 reports wrong battery percentage after a cell swap\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eThe fuel gauge IC on the C5300 builds its percentage model against the discharge curve of the old cell. When a new cell goes in, that stored curve no longer matches actual cell behaviour. The IC interpolates against stale data and reports inaccurate state-of-charge figures until it recalibrates. One full discharge-to-shutoff followed by an uninterrupted charge cycle overwrites the old curve and re-anchors the gauge to the new cell.\u003c\/p\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eSudden shutdown at 20–30% on the replacement cell\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eThis happens when the cell voltage drops below the modem or display load threshold faster than the fuel gauge predicted — a voltage cliff the uncalibrated IC did not anticipate. Under peak modem transmit or screen-on current, a fresh cell not yet profiled by the coulomb counter can sag below the SoC cutoff point while the display still reads 25%. After one complete discharge-charge calibration cycle, the gauge tracks the actual voltage curve and the early shutdowns stop. If shutdowns continue past two full cycles, check that cell voltage at rest reads above 3.6V before charging.\u003c\/p\u003e\n\u003c\/div\u003e","brand":"BatteryWeb","offers":[{"title":"Warranty 1 Year","offer_id":43404286459994,"sku":"BWCS-DEP215SL-1","price":23.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 2 Year","offer_id":43404286492762,"sku":"BWCS-DEP215SL-2","price":26.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 3 Year","offer_id":43404286525530,"sku":"BWCS-DEP215SL-3","price":28.99,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0674\/4775\/0746\/files\/BW-CS-DEP215SL-1.webp?v=1779369550","url":"https:\/\/batteryweb.com\/products\/spice-c5300-replacement-battery-37v-1200mah-li-ion","provider":"BatteryWeb","version":"1.0","type":"link"}
